Lively and bright Elizabeth Bennet encounters interfering parents,
squabbling sisters, snobbish aristocrats and her own mistaken
prejudices on her way to the alarming realization that she is in love
with a man whom she professes to despise and who finds her barely
tolerable. Or does he? Directed by Jeff-nominated Northwestern
University faculty member Jessica Thebus and adapted by Joseph Hanreddy
and J.R. Sullivan, Jane Austen’s classic novel of attraction, vanity,
manners and marriage sparkles with dancing, romance, wit and the
“inconsistency of all human characters.”
